Aims and Scope

International Journal of Wireless Communications and Mobile Computing (ISSN Online: 2330-1015, ISSN Print: 2330-1007) a peer-reviewed open access journal published bimonthly in English-language, aims to foster a wider academic interest in this fast moving field, and publishes a wide range of researches on the R&D communities working in academia and the telecommunications and networking industries with a forum for sharing research and ideas. In addition, papers on specific topics or on more non-traditional topics related to specific application areas, are encouraged.
